Background Disparities in acute myeloid leukemia (AML) outcomes due to nonbiological factors, including socioeconomic (SE) status and race/ethnicity, have been observed in population-based studies. However, inconsistent assessment of SE status limits translation to clinical practice. Objective To evaluate the impact of neighborhood disadvantage status and race/ethnicity on AML outcomes. Methods Adult patients with newly diagnosed untreated AML, self-reported race/ethnicity, and available Area Deprivation Index (ADI) based on zip code at diagnosis were included. Primary outcome was overall survival (OS). Multivariable Cox regression analyzed factors associated with OS. Results Of 2442 patients, 2032 (83%) were non-Hispanic White, 202 (8%) were non-Hispanic Black, 109 (5%) were Hispanic, and 99 (4%) were Asian. Median ADI rank was 53 (IQR, 32-73). No differences in clinical trial participation across racial/ethnic groups were observed. Stem cell transplant rates were lower in more disadvantaged neighborhoods (higher ADI ranks, ≥ 53: 16% vs. 20%, P = .007). In multivariable analysis, clinical trial participation (HR 0.72, [95% CI, 0.63-0.81], P < .001) and transplant (HR 0.43, [95% CI, 0.36-0.51], P < .001) were associated with improved OS. Neither ADI rank nor race/ethnicity affected OS. Conclusions and Relevance In a large academic center, neighborhood disadvantage and race/ethnicity did not affect AML outcomes. Equitable access to clinical trials and novel therapies appears to mitigate SE and racial/ethnic disparities. These findings suggest academic centers can serve as models for reducing inequities through policy and clinical interventions. Prospective multicenter studies are needed to validate these findings.
